The National Monuments Service's description

On a SW-facing slope overlooking a NW-SE section of the River Suck, c. 25m to the SW. Circular grass-covered area (diam. 59.4m N-S) with a few trees defined by a rounded fosse (Wth of top 6.4-7.7m; Wth of base 2-3m; int. D 0.8-1.5m; ext. D 1.2-1.8m), and an outer bank (Wth 4.2-6.2m; ext. H 0.3-1.7m) WSW-N-SSE, the river or the slope having removed the bank elsewhere (max. ext. diam. 79m N-S). There is an entrance (Wth 5.4m) and a modern causeway (Wth 2.6m; H 0.45m) of limestone blocks at N. There are traces of a second outer fosse (Wth of base 3.4m; D 0.3m) and external bank (Wth 3.3m; ext. H 0.25m) NE-ENE.
